Lines Matching refs:ExtendKind
510 ISD::NodeType ExtendKind = ISD::ANY_EXTEND) { in getCopyToParts() argument
555 Val = DAG.getNode(ExtendKind, DL, ValueVT, Val); in getCopyToParts()
969 ISD::NodeType ExtendKind = PreferredExtendType; in getCopyToRegs() local
982 if (ExtendKind == ISD::ANY_EXTEND && TLI.isZExtFree(Val, RegisterVT)) in getCopyToRegs()
983 ExtendKind = ISD::ZERO_EXTEND; in getCopyToRegs()
986 NumParts, RegisterVT, V, CallConv, ExtendKind); in getCopyToRegs()
2244 ISD::NodeType ExtendKind = ISD::ANY_EXTEND; in visitRet() local
2246 ExtendKind = ISD::SIGN_EXTEND; in visitRet()
2248 ExtendKind = ISD::ZERO_EXTEND; in visitRet()
2256 if (ExtendKind != ISD::ANY_EXTEND && VT.isInteger()) in visitRet()
2257 VT = TLI.getTypeForExtReturn(Context, VT, ExtendKind); in visitRet()
2266 &Parts[0], NumParts, PartVT, &I, CC, ExtendKind); in visitRet()
2286 if (ExtendKind == ISD::SIGN_EXTEND) in visitRet()
2288 else if (ExtendKind == ISD::ZERO_EXTEND) in visitRet()
11028 ISD::NodeType ExtendKind = ISD::ANY_EXTEND; in LowerCallTo() local
11031 ExtendKind = ISD::SIGN_EXTEND; in LowerCallTo()
11033 ExtendKind = ISD::ZERO_EXTEND; in LowerCallTo()
11055 (ExtendKind != ISD::ANY_EXTEND && CLI.RetSExt == Args[i].IsSExt && in LowerCallTo()
11061 CLI.CallConv, ExtendKind); in LowerCallTo()